Users will find this to be a timely and essential resource for addressing the growing challenges of drought in an era of climate change with its actionable insights and practical solutions to safeguard water resources and build resilience in human and ecological systems. By examining the interplay of climate patterns, water resource management, and environmental sustainability, the book emphasizes the need for important technologies and frameworks to tackle these issues globally.
Professor Fares served on administrative positions as Interim Vice President of Research, Interim Dean and Director, and Associate Director of Research. He served as a Professor of watershed hydrology at the University of Hawaii-Manoa for 11 years during which he established an academic water resource program. He has trained tens of students and post-doctoral fellows. He developed water allocation software packages for Hawaii sand contributed to multiple statewide initiatives. He worked on citrus best management practices at the University of Florida. Professor Fares is/was a PI and Co-PI on $26 million research funding, half of which are currently active. He has 115 articles, is Series Editor of the Advances in Water Security book series, has given several keynote presentations, and organized several international conferences and workshops. He received his M.S and Doctoral Degrees from the University of Florida and he also received his B.S of Horticultural Engineering, University of Sussa, Tunisia.
